**Q: What do I do during a fire drill?**

Easy — grab the visitor log, head to the muster point by the Wrenfold gates, and read out names as people arrive. Wardens in orange vests handle the rest. Don't go back inside until they say so. To reopen the lobby afterwards, punch in the code below.

door code, yagap-bahof: bdg-O-05

## Connection Pooling — Quickfern API

Welcome to the Quickfern backend team. Our service maintains a shared pool of connections to the Larkspur database cluster. Never open raw connections in handler code; always borrow from the pool, and return connections promptly in a finally block. Exhausting the pool causes cascading timeouts upstream, which is our most common incident class. Pool sizing was tuned after the March load tests, so change values only with a reviewed proposal. The current production settings are as follows.

settings of fafog-haduf:
ZORIX_PIN=4648
ZORIX_METRICS_HOST=metrics.zorix.paliqsys.corp
ZORIX_LOG_LEVEL=info
ZORIX_TENANT=druix

# Budget Request: Kestrel Analytics Expansion (Managers Only)

The Kestrel team requests incremental funding for two additional data engineers and expanded compute capacity through year-end. The request reflects sustained demand from the Northvale rollout and a backlog of reporting commitments. Department heads should note the trade-off: deferral would push the Harwick integration into next year. Review comments are due before Friday's planning session. The confidential note on business plans follows directly below.

internal memo for hahaf-kahof: Only 39 of the 428 pilot accounts renewed Sorion, so a churn review is set for April 12. Praokix Freight is in early talks to buy Queniusox Group for about $145.8 million.

TURN-208: Gatevale turnstile counters at the Merrow Field pilot double-count when a rotation reverses mid-cycle. Attendance totals drift roughly 2% high per event. The debounce window fix is implemented, reviewed by Ilsa, and soak-tested across two simulated match days without drift. Ready for your cut; the candidate build is identified below.

trace token, tagag-tafog: htk6_5ed18c